MORE IMPORTANT INFORMATION ABOUT YOUR TRAVEL TO Flensburg

Flensburg (Deens, Nedersaksisch: Flensborg; Noord-Fries: Flansborj; Zuid-Jutland: Flensborre) is een onafhankelijke stad (kreisfreie Stadt) in het noorden van de Duitse deelstaat Sleeswijk-Holstein. Flensburg is het centrum van de regio Zuid-Sleeswijk. Na Kiel en Lübeck is het de derde stad van Sleeswijk-Holstein. In mei 1945 was Flensburg de zetel van de laatste regering van nazi-Duitsland, de zogenaamde Flensburg-regering onder leiding van Karl Dönitz, die aan de macht was vanaf 1 mei, de aankondiging van Hitlers dood, gedurende een week, totdat de Duitse legers zich overgaven en de stad werd bezet door geallieerde troepen. Het regime is op 23 mei officieel ontbonden.

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ION ABOUT Frankfurt

Frankfurt (officieel: Frankfurt am Main (Duits: [ˈfʁaŋkfʊʁt ʔam ˈmaɪn]; Hessian: Frangford am Maa; letterlijk "Frank Ford op de Main")) is een metropool en de grootste stad van de Duitse deelstaat Hessen, en haar Met 746.878 (2017) inwoners is het de op vier na grootste stad van Duitsland. Aan de rivier de Main (een zijrivier van de Rijn) vormt het een continue agglomeratie met de naburige stad Offenbach am Main en heeft het stedelijke gebied 2,3 miljoen inwoners. De stad ligt in het centrum van de grotere metropoolregio Rijn-Main, met 5,5 miljoen inwoners en is na het Rijn-Ruhrgebied de op één na grootste metropoolregio van Duitsland. Sinds de uitbreiding van de Europese Unie in 2013 ligt het geografische centrum van de EU ongeveer 40 km (25 mijl) ten oosten van de centrale zakenwijk van Frankfurt. Net als Frankrijk en Franken is de stad vernoemd naar de Franken.
